To achieve melt-in-your-mouth tenderness and an explosion of flavors, start with selecting high-quality beef ribs. Opt for well-marbled cuts that promise richness and depth. The secret to the perfect beef ribs lies in a meticulously crafted marinade. Create a symphony of flavors by combining savory soy sauce, smoky Worcestershire sauce, fragrant garlic, and a touch of sweetness from brown sugar. Allow the beef ribs to luxuriate in this concoction, marinating for at least four hours or, ideally, overnight. This infusion of flavors will penetrate the meat, promising a depth that will leave your taste buds dancing. As your beef ribs absorb the marinade, preheat your oven to a moderate temperature, typically around 300°F 150°C. This slow-cooking method ensures that the meat becomes tender while allowing the flavors to develop harmoniously. Patience is key in the pursuit of perfection, as slow-roasting the beef ribs will reward you with a succulence that cannot be rushed.
Once the ribs have marinated to perfection, transfer them to a roasting pan, allowing any excess marinade to cling to the meat. Cover the pan tightly with foil, creating a cocoon that will trap the juices and intensify the flavors during the cooking process. Slide the pan into the preheated oven, and let the magic unfold over the next few hours. The low and slow roasting method ensures that the collagen in the beef breaks down, resulting in a tender and juicy masterpiece. Baste the ribs intermittently with their own juices to keep them moist and infuse every fiber with the richness of the marinade. About halfway through the cooking process, unveil the foil to allow the exterior to develop a tantalizing crust, adding a textural contrast to the tender interior.
To elevate the flavor profile even further, consider adding a final glaze in the last stages of cooking. Whether it is a savory barbecue sauce or a honey-based glaze, brush it generously over the ribs, allowing it to caramelize and create a glossy finish. This additional layer of flavor will enhance the overall taste experience, making each bite a symphony of sweet, savory, and smoky notes. As the aroma of perfectly roasted beef ribs wafts through your kitchen, resist the temptation to immediately indulge. Allow the ribs to rest for a few minutes, letting the juices redistribute and intensify the succulence.
